How much do hand packing j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for hand packing in the United States is $15.87,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$17.07 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Hand Packer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Hand Packer, you need attention to detail, manual dexterity, basic math skills,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with packaging machinery, barcode scanners, and inventory tracking systems is often required. Strong work ethic, reliability, and the ability to work well in a team are standout soft skills in this role. These skills ensure accurate, efficient packing and help maintain product quality and workflow in a fast-paced environment.

What are some common challenges faced in a hand packing role, and how can they be managed?

Hand packing roles often involve repetitive tasks, working on tight deadlines, and maintaining quality standards, which can be physically demanding. Managing these challenges involves staying organized, following established safety and ergonomic guidelines, and communicating effectively with team members and supervisors. Taking regular short breaks, using proper lifting techniques, and being attentive to detail can help reduce fatigue and minimize errors. Experienced employees often find that developing a steady workflow and staying proactive about workplace safety are key to long-term success in this role.

What are hand packers?

Hand packers are workers responsible for manually packaging products in factories, warehouses, or production facilities. They inspect items for quality, count and sort products, and place them into containers or packages by hand. Hand packers also label, seal, and prepare packaged goods for shipment or storage, often working on assembly lines or in teams to meet production targets. This role requires attention to detail, manual dexterity, and the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ment.

What is the difference between Hand Packing vs Assembly Line Worker?

AspectHand PackingAssembly Line Worker
CredentialsNo formal certifications typically requiredNo formal certifications typically required
Work EnvironmentSmall stations, manual handling, close-up workLarge-scale production lines, repetitive tasks
Industry UsageWarehousing, manufacturing, packagingManufacturing, automotive, electronics
Work TasksManually packing products into boxes or containersAssembling products or components on a line

Hand Packing involves manually packing items into containers, focusing on precision and care. Assembly Line Workers operate on production lines, performing repetitive tasks to assemble products efficiently. While both roles are common in manufacturing and packaging industries, Hand Packing emphasizes manual handling and detail, whereas Assembly Line work centers on speed and consistency.

Sonoco is a $5 billion global provider of consumer packaging, industrial products and packaging supply chain services. When collaborating with our customers, we leverage our deep knowledge of material science, our i6 Innovation ProcessTM, and our industry-leading packaging and services portfolio to create impactful customized solutions that build stronger brands. We produce packaging for many of the world's most recognized brands, in markets such as appliances and electronics, automotive, beverages, confection, construction, converted paperboard, fresh and natural food, frozen and refrigerated food, shaving, home, lawn and garden, medical/pharmaceutical, pet care, powdered beverages, recycling and snacks. Sonoco's operations consist of our global consumer packaging businesses (rigid paper and closures, flexibles and plastics); our display and packaging division (high-impact retail displays and packaging supply chain management); our industrial businesses (tubes and cores, reels and spools, uncoated recycled paperboard and Sonoco Recycling, one of the world's largest recyclers); and our Protective Solutions division (custom-designed protective, temperature-assurance and retail security packaging solutions and highly engineered components). From our headquarters in Hartsville, S.C., and more than 300 operations in 33 countries, we serve customers in 85 nations.
